Output fb7f806c26bf76831a923946e015053fe0f572b44f07130ece39a86a25ae5ef4:0

value
20584
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fcc26fb8089ec7c5d75291aed74f76076b6d5a0 OP_EQUALVERIFY OP_CHECKSIG
address
1E7LCBUCpUztpYT5GVNcGiANurnQmbjXnA
transaction
fb7f806c26bf76831a923946e015053fe0f572b44f07130ece39a86a25ae5ef4
confirmations
289756
spent
true